Hawks Stopped by Lehman

Box Score

BRONX, NY -On Monday night, February 7, the women's basketball team took on the Lightning of Lehman College in their tenth conference game of the season. Despite a combine 40 point effort by the freshman duo of Nicole Lenard and Kristen Markoe, the Lightning proved to be too much to handle as they took the lead late in the first half and never looked back, taking the 68-54 win. With the loss, the Hawks drop to 8-14, 5-5 CUNYAC while Lehman advances to 14-9, 8-4 CUNYAC.

The Lightning got on the board first on a jumper by Amanda De La Cruz, but Markoe responded with back to back three pointers to make it a 6-2 game. Over the next 7:37, the Hawks strung together a 15-4 run, sparked by a Lenard layup, and capped with a three pointer by Johanna Keilwitz. However, in the remaining 10 minutes, Hunter fell out of rhythm and fell victim to a 24-2 run that closed out the first half, falling behind 32-23.

Lenard finally broke the scoring drought at the 17:18 mark when she connected on a jumper in an effort to light a spark under her team, but nothing seemed to fall into place for the Hawks who continued to struggle from behind the arc as they shot just one for six. Lehman, on the strength of Louvinia Hayes' 30 points and Jaleesa Gordon's 23, powered away, extending their lead to as much as 18 and putting the game out of reach early in the second half.

Lenard led the Hawks with 21 points and 11 rebounds while Markoe chipped in with 19 points and 9 rebounds. Johanna Keilwitz added nine points while senior Christina Baker grabbed seven boards.

The Hawks return to action on Wednesday, February 9 when they host the Beavers of CCNY in the first of their final three games of the regular season. Tipoff is scheduled for 5:00 pm.
